Need help on saving memory for very large video
I'm working on a large scaIe video. I just have a few questions as I am experiencing memory problems and crashes. Just shooting some ideas with people who understand the bottlenecks of the AE.
I have a about 300 objects in the design which is part of the logo. I got this really nice wipe effect that which uses a gradient controller to driver the opacity. So it looks really great when effected.
This involves putting in this onto opacity:
C = thisComp.layer("grad").sampleImage(position,[.5,.5],true,time);
L = rgbToHsl(C)[2]*100
Are expressions more computational that regular key frames?
With vector images, does after effects have to use a lot of brain power to 'contiuously rasterize' a small illustrator file by 1000% closer to the size need. Is it better to upscale in illustrator before?
There other things like switching colour profiling to 'fast' which I'm looking at.
And 'hardware Accelerate' options. I'm not sure if it is making much difference yet.
